you mean a 'shadow' or a satin stitch outline around the 'filled'  
letter?
I haven't had good luck with shadow yet, but have 'outlined'  
lettering...
screwy thing is, it went through the word, and made an 'inside' and  
'border' on each letter, with
a color change between each, so 10 letters became 20 color changes! I  
wanted 'inside' lettering
sewn first, THEN all the 'outer' stitching done afterwards to save  
all the needle changes.
Probably a way to set it to do that...
Anyways, page 121 of my manual, see 'lettering tab' where you set  
your font, size, stitch order, etc. when you go to 'properties' on  
your lettering.
just under the lettering 'window', on the right...under Code Sheet  
button...
Auto Borders On. click the ... box to change things.
Aha! that's where I can set it to 'stitch borders last'....
helps when you read the book!
